Beyond anthropomorphism: a spectrum of interface metaphors for LLMs

Proposes a spectrum of interface metaphors for LLMs beyond the default anthropomorphic framing. Different metaphors (tool, oracle, collaborator, environment) carry different implications for user expectations and design.

Proposes metaphors beyond the anthropomorphic default. So et al. map a spectrum from tool to oracle to collaborator to environment, arguing that the choice of metaphor shapes user expectations, error tolerance, and the kinds of interactions that feel appropriate. The anthropomorphic framing is one option, not a neutral default.
